A Demand-Side Platform (DSP)
A DSP is a technology solution that empowers advertisers to buy digital advertising inventory across various platforms and channels in an automated manner. Allows advertisers to effectively target their desired audience segments based on demographics. DSPs provide a centralized platform for managing ad campaigns, allowing advertisers to fine-tune bids in real-time and measure campaign performance.
